One88 Luxury Condo Project Releases Pricing from $900K


Bellevue’s first condominium building in nearly a decade, One88, has released pricing for the 21-story residential tower. The price range for the luxury residential tower runs from $900k to $6M.

Located at the intersection of Bellevue Way Northeast and Northeast second, the luxury condos feature 147 one, two and three-bedroom residences, as well as penthouse residences. Units with two and three bedrooms will make up 80% of the building. There will be no studios offered.

The sales gallery for One88 is planned to open in early 2018. The units will run between 750 to 2,900 square feet. For more information on the project or to sign-up for pre-sale information visit the One88 website.
